Angela Sun

Angela Sun is an American journalist television presenter sportscaster and documentary filmmaker. Born on 19 October 1979, in Santa Clara County of California Angela Sun is an Award-Winning Journalist Sportscaster and actor. She holds a bachelor's master's degree in sociology and communications from the University of California. Sun has excellent surfing abilities. She took part in various pro-am Surf competitions which helped her get sponsorships by brands such as Roxy Reef Billabong Vans. The recognition she received through these occasions was similar to a rocket that helped her get into the entertainment industry. She, later on went to be a sportscaster actress investigative journalist and film director. Sun was a anchor who has worked on various news channels. Sun was employed by Fox Sports Net as a reporter in 2003. In 2012, she hosted American Ninja Warrior, alongside Matt Iseman. In 2014, Sun was host of The Yahoo Sports Minute. Sun is the first Asian American person to have appeared on ESPN Fox Sports Yahoo Sports Tennis Channel. Sun has worked in numerous films, and her talents as an actor are lauded and acknowledged. She has appeared in many films, including Goliath (2017) Hit the Floor (2014-2016), A Perfect Getaway (2009) Shackled (2015) Street Kings (2008) and Glowsticks and Drumsticks (2005). Sun, who wrote and directed her documentary Platic Paradise The Great Pacific Garbage Patch about marine plastic pollution and the impacts on the planet in 2014, released the feature length film.
